G1718

ἐμφανίζω

emphanizo

em-fan-id'-zo

Verb

from G1717; to exhibit (in person) or disclose (by words):--appear, declare (plainly), inform, (will) manifest, shew, signify.

  1. to manifest, exhibit to view
  2. to show one's self, come to view, appear, be manifest
  3. to indicate, disclose, declare, make known


Strong's Number G1718 Bible Verses

G5316

φαίνω

phaino

fah'-ee-no

Verb

prolongation for the base of G5457; to lighten (shine), i.e. show (transitive or intransitive, literal or figurative):-- appear, seem, be seen, shine, × think.

  1. to bring forth into the light, cause to shine, shed light
  2. shine
    1. to shine, be bright or resplendent
    2. to become evident, to be brought forth into the light, come to view, appear
      1. of growing vegetation, to come to light
      2. to appear, be seen
      3. exposed to view
    3. to meet the eyes, strike the sight, become clear or manifest
      1. to be seen, appear
    4. to appear to the mind, seem to one's judgment or opinion


Strong's Number G5316 Bible Verses

G5319

φανερόω

phaneroo

fan-er-o'-o

Verb

from G5318; to render apparent (literally or figuratively):--appear, manifestly declare, (make) manifest (forth), shew (self).

  1. to make manifest or visible or known what has been hidden or unknown, to manifest, whether by words, or deeds, or in any other way
    1. make actual and visible, realised
    2. to make known by teaching
    3. to become manifest, be made known
    4. of a person
      1. expose to view, make manifest, to show one's self, appear
    5. to become known, to be plainly recognised, thoroughly understood
      1. who and what one is


Strong's Number G5319 Bible Verses
